What is the healthiest poop shape?

Healthy stool is typically sausage-shaped and snake-like. It is easy to pass, and it remains intact when it is flushed.

Is floating poop good or bad?

Floating stools are often an indication of high fat content, which can be a sign of malabsorption, a condition in which you can't absorb enough fat and other nutrients from the food you're ingesting. When your poop (stool) floats, it is associated with celiac disease or chronic pancreatitis.Dec 19, 2017

What is a Ghosty poo?

Dr. Islam gives us three definitions of the elusive ghost poop: 1) the urge to poop that ends up only being gas, 2) a poop so smooth that it went down the drain before you could see it, and lastly 3) a visible poop in the toilet, but zero poop marks on your toilet paper after wiping.Sep 20, 2021

What is it called when you poop and don't wipe?

Bowel leakage is also known as fecal incontinence. It occurs when you have a hard time holding in a bowel movement. You may leak stool when you pass gas, or find you leak stool throughout the course of the day.Jan 12, 2021
